    I live in a very long house so the system is as follows:
    Rear of house
    Bigpond standard modem to Dlink DI524 router. This router is set to assign all IP addresses dynamically. Two laptops (1 xp and 1 Wn98) connect to the router wirelessly.
    Also connected to the DI524 by cable is a Dlink AP2000 set in bridging mode.

    Front of house
    Dlink AP2100 which picks up the signal from the AP2000 at the rear. 2 desktops are connected wirelessly to this (AP2100)

    I've run latest Spybot and Avast software and also Ccleaner.

    All computers are set to
    SSID default
    IP dynamic
    Gateway 192.168.0.1
    Subnet 255.255.255.0

    Everything has been running fine for a couple of months. (file/printer sharing and internet etc.)

    My problem is that one the front computers (Win98) now won't connect to the internet. It sees & connects to all the other computers but when I ping the modem (10.0.0.138) there is no response. I've used winipcfg to renew the lease to no avail.

    Any ideas ?
